ISP uses the SAFE-T system. Which is the backup system for Tippi. There is a slight difference with the EFJ P25 from Harris and Motorola P25 that plays hell on the older P25 scanners like the PRO-96 and 2096 and the older Unidens. Not sure why but they just won't cut it on the EFJ. I verified it using 2 PRO-96s and also my Unidens both BCD396XT and BCD436HP. The Unidens worked. The old 96s couldn't hack it. And the 96s work on the SAFE-T simulcasts and IDPS Simulcasts.

Tippy and Pro96

OK - got it figured out - almost
Using Arc96:
Frequencies: I have all Freqs from RR import but set them as 'FM/P25'
Settings: Bank Type: Not Trunked
everything else default (Normal bandplans)

I loaded the frqs with Alpha display 'Tippecanoe C'. This shows in the display rather than the talk group. Trying to remember how to make talkgroup instead.

getting closer - -at least I can hear traffic now....
